Why Your Summer Scents Need a Seasonal Swap
Summer fragrances are typically formulated to be light and refreshing—think citrus, bergamot, sea salt, and sheer florals. These notes evaporate quickly in high heat, which is actually desirable when you're sweating at a beach barbecue. But as temperatures drop, those same scents can feel thin and fleeting. Fall demands fragrances with more body and warmth, often built around base notes like vanilla, amber, sandalwood, and tonka bean. These heavier molecules cling to the skin longer in cooler weather, giving you that all-day scent experience.
Moreover, the psychological shift matters. Fall is associated with comfort, nostalgia, and indulgence. Scents that evoke baked goods, warm spices, or woody cabins align perfectly with the season's mood. By swapping your summer spritz for a gourmand or oriental fragrance, you not only smell appropriate for the season but also tap into a deeper emotional connection with your environment. It's a small change that can dramatically uplift your daily routine.
- Look for fragrances with notes of pumpkin, cinnamon, caramel, or cashmere for instant fall vibes.
- Avoid overly aquatic or citrus-forward perfumes once the mercury drops below 60°F.
Top Fall Fragrance Notes to Look For
When curating your autumn scent collection, focus on notes that feel like a warm hug. Gourmand notes—such as vanilla, chocolate, honey, and caramel—are perennial favorites because they remind us of baking and holiday treats. Spices like nutmeg, clove, and cardamom add a festive kick, while woody and smoky accords (cedar, vetiver, oud) ground the scent and give it sophistication. Floral lovers don't have to despair; opt for deeper blooms like rose, jasmine, or tuberose, which hold up better in cooler air than delicate peonies or lilies.
